Kinda hard to hear this song because there are so many chords in it but this is what my ear gave me:

A/Ab,B,E        IT'S SO EASY TO LOVE YOU
A/Gb,B,Eb

Ab/Ab,B,Eb     IT'S SO EASY TO LOVE YOU
Ab/B,Db,Eb,Gb

Gb/A,Db,E      IT'S SO EASY TO LOVE YOU
Ab
A
B/Gb,B,Eb
Gb/B,Db,Eb,Gb    CAUSE YOUR WONDER-
E/Ab,B,E              -FUL

Gb/Gb,B,Eb         (TRANSITION CHORDS)
Ab/Gb,B,Eb
{BACK TO THE TOP}


(THIS IS ONE OF THOSE SIMPLE BUT AFFECTIVE SONGS LIKE "LET IT RAIN.")

Just Another Way To Play It
« Reply #3 on: January 27, 2005, 01:22:25 PM »
I like your version to the song it's pretty, I was taught by my piano teacher this way: :)


-/Eb IT'S
-/F   SO
-/G  OOO
Ab/GCEbG EASY TO LOVE YOU
-/Eb ITS
-/F   SO
-/G  OO
G/GBbEbG EASY TO LOVE YOU
F#/EAbBbDb SO
F/AbBbCEb EASY TO LOVE YOU CAUSE YOUR
Bb/DbFAb WONDER
A/GBbDbEb FUL

REPEAT
